How coverage differs
Left outlets emphasize the state's fight against widespread healthcare fraud, while right outlets focus on how criminals exploited California's Medi-Cal system and its vulnerability.
- Left: Massive hospice fraud scheme exploited vulnerable state healthcare system Left-leaning outlets report on California's felony charges against 21 individuals involved in an alleged $267 million hospice fraud scheme, emphasizing the significant financial exploitation. They highlight the state's efforts to combat widespread healthcare fraud.
- Right: Arrests made in $267M hospice fraud exploiting state's Medi-Cal program Right-leaning outlets focus on the arrests of five individuals in the alleged $267 million hospice fraud scheme, specifically highlighting how the criminals exploited California's Medi-Cal system. They underscore the vulnerability of public healthcare programs to such extensive fraud.
